The Tengri Partners Kazakhstan Composite PMI edged down to 49.5 in November of 2022 from 49.8 in October, pointing to the third straight month of contraction in the private sector led by a renewed downturn across the service sector, while goods producers reported growth for the first time in three months. Output showed no growth, thereby ending a six-month run of growth. Meanwhile, employment continued to increase, with manufacturing firms reporting a slightly quicker upturn in payroll numbers during the latest survey period. On the pricing front, both input price and output charge inflation softened to a nine-month low, but remained historically elevated. Lastly, business confidence improved to a three-month high, largely as a result of sentiment strengthening at goods producers.
